i listened to this on my phone and it sounded bad and on a studio set up this song sounds heavenly 10/10 im going to listen to it for like 15 minutes. so yeah, your mastering must be kinda wack. All i can say is that a better than average mix does not need to be well mastered. from how bad it sounded on the phone im guessing you never mix in mono. I mix in mono until the final stages of mixing where i do the panning, widening and narrowing. I learned this from soundmindbeats idk if you know who that is. if it doesnt sound good in mono it doesnt sound good. Unless youre producing for hifi only

I just read your post body and see youre aware of the issue. Please keep working on this and dont give up. This song needs to be finished because it's one of the special ones. work on the mix before you go back to working on your mastering and you will have an easier mastering job
